Title: How to mix textures?
Post by: Manu on January 20, 2017, 12:15:11 PM
I have noticed that in victoria circuit the terrain around the track has two mixed textures. What is the method to do this?



Terrain tile texture mixed with satellite image
(https://s23.postimg.org/gkzus023v/victoria_blend.png)
Title: Re: How to mix textures?
Post by: PiBoSo on January 20, 2017, 04:27:16 PM

Using the opacity channel:

Title: Re: How to mix textures?
Post by: Hawk on January 20, 2017, 06:03:37 PM
Quote from: Manu on January 20, 2017, 05:34:06 PM
Thank you very much! works perfectly

Did you use the FBX2EDF converter to successfully do that Manu? I couldn't get that to work with the FBX2EDF converter on the opacity channel exporting the FBX file from Maya.  Unless unbeknown to me Piboso has fixed it? :-\

Hawk.
Title: Re: How to mix textures?
Post by: PiBoSo on January 20, 2017, 06:14:11 PM
Quote from: Hawk on January 20, 2017, 06:03:37 PM
Quote from: Manu on January 20, 2017, 05:34:06 PM
Thank you very much! works perfectly

Did you use the FBX2EDF converter to successfully do that Manu? I couldn't get that to work with the FBX2EDF converter on the opacity channel exporting the FBX file from Maya.  Unless unbeknown to me Piboso has fixed it? :-\

Hawk.

Unfortunately at the moment the FBX2EDF converted doesn't support textures blending.
